6.11.3.2. Data Parameters
Data Parameters are actual types of the data may be measured and stored by the
iDAS. For each of T-API's instrument models, the list of available data parameters is
set and non-customizable (see Appendix F for a list of available Data Parameters for
this instrument).
Most data parameters have measurement units associated with them, such as mV,
PPB, cc/m, etc., although some have no units. The iDAS is not designed to permit
these units to be changed.
Each Data Parameters has user-configurable functions that define how the data is
recorded.

Table 6-21: iDAS Data Channel Properties

Description
The data channel's name (for reports and RS-
232 access).
The event that triggers this data channel to
measure and store its data parameters.
See Appendix F for a list of available triggering
events
A User-configurable list of data types to be
recorded.
See Appendix F for a list of available
parameters.
The amount of time between each report.
The number of reports that will be stored in the
data file.
Indicates whether or not a report will be printed
automatically to the RS-232 channel.
Provides a convenient means to temporarily
disable a data channel.
Disables sampling of data parameters while
instrument is in calibration mode.
